Understanding Ocean Marine Insurance

Before diving into the specifics of Ocean Marine Insurance in Connecticut, it's crucial to understand what this insurance type entails. Ocean Marine Insurance is a form of transit insurance that covers cargo loss or damage, ships or vessels, and any terminal where the cargo is held, transferred, or acquired. It's a vital safety net for businesses involved in maritime trade.


Unlike other insurance types, Ocean Marine Insurance is steeped in centuries of maritime law and tradition. It's based on the principles of "utmost good faith," meaning that all parties involved must disclose all information that could potentially affect the policy's terms and conditions.

Types of Ocean Marine Insurance

There are several types of Ocean Marine Insurance, each designed to cover specific risks associated with maritime trade. Understanding these types can help you choose the right policy for your business.


Hull Insurance


Hull Insurance covers physical damage to the ship or vessel. It's akin to auto insurance for cars, providing coverage for any damage to the ship due to accidents, weather conditions, or other unforeseen circumstances.


It's important to note that Hull Insurance typically covers only the ship's hull and machinery. Other parts of the ship, such as the cargo, are covered under different policies.


Cargo Insurance


Cargo Insurance, as the name suggests, covers the cargo being transported. This includes coverage for loss or damage due to accidents, theft, or other risks. It's crucial for businesses that transport goods across the ocean, as it provides financial protection against unexpected losses.


There are different types of Cargo Insurance policies, including All Risk, Free of Particular Average (FPA), and With Average (WA). Each offers varying levels of coverage, so it's essential to understand what each policy entails before making a decision.


Liability Insurance


Liability Insurance, also known as Protection and Indemnity (P&I) Insurance, covers legal liabilities that may arise from maritime operations. This includes liabilities for injury or death of crew members, damage to other vessels or structures, and pollution.


Liability Insurance is a crucial component of Ocean Marine Insurance, as it protects businesses from potentially crippling legal costs.

Choosing the Right Ocean Marine Insurance in Connecticut

Choosing the right Ocean Marine Insurance policy in Connecticut involves several factors. These include the type of vessel, the nature of the cargo, the routes taken, and the specific risks associated with your operations.


It's advisable to work with an experienced insurance broker who understands the complexities of Ocean Marine Insurance. They can guide you through the process, helping you choose a policy that best fits your business needs.


Remember, the cheapest policy isn't always the best. It's crucial to consider the coverage provided and whether it adequately protects your business against potential risks.
